For review: the compactor keeps the latest record per key and discards superseded entries once segments pass COMPACT_MIN_AGE_HOURS. Reviewers should confirm that COMPACT_SEGMENT_BYTES stays aligned with the broker's segment size, otherwise compaction stalls silently and disk usage climbs. All compactor settings live in the service env file, loaded at startup only. The compactor also needs authenticated access to the Quillstream admin endpoint to trigger segment rolls, and the line directly below sets that credential.

secret setting of yafof-tawep: RELAY_SECRET8=8abb5772

// Config hot-reloading for the Brindlemere client.
// The watcher polls /etc/brindlemere/client.toml every 15s and applies
// changes without a restart. Connection pool size, retry budgets, and
// timeout values are all reloadable; endpoint URLs are not, by design,
// since swapping hosts mid-flight corrupted the session cache in the
// 3.2 release. Reload events are logged at INFO so the release manager
// can confirm rollout without shelling in. The client authenticates to
// the internal Fennic registry with the key that follows.

app token of tageg-kadug = vxb2-26

## Deploying the Gatewick Proctor Queue

Deploys are pretty painless: push to main, wait for the pipeline, then watch the queue drain dashboard for five minutes. If candidates pile up mid-exam, roll back first and ask questions later — the queue replays safely. Everything the workers care about lives in one config block, shown here for reference.

settings of bafof-yagef:
JOROX_PIN=8740
JOROX_TENANT=pelox
JOROX_METRICS_HOST=metrics.jorox.qorvelworks.internal
JOROX_SEAL=seal_c78f63c1
JOROX_STANDBY_TEAM=norax

## Changelog — Shorepulse tide widget (weekly sync)

Defaults changed in 2.7. The tide-table widget now refreshes predictions every 30 minutes instead of hourly, and falls back to cached harmonics when the prediction service is slow. Datum defaults to mean lower low water rather than chart datum, which matched user expectations better in testing. Extreme-tide highlighting is now on by default. Existing embeds keep their saved settings; only new embeds pick these up. Current default configuration follows.

settings of kajep-kajop:
OLIDOR_LOG_LEVEL=info
OLIDOR_METRICS_HOST=metrics.olidor.norvacorp.corp
OLIDOR_POOL_SIZE=4